Tyner, James Monroe

MYRTLE BEACH -DILLON-James Monroe Tyner, age 80, of Tyner St., died Sunday,
Feb. 27, 2005 at Grand Strand Regional Medical Center.

Born June 4, 1924 in Dillon, he was the son of the late Thomas D. and Eva
Mae Baxley Tyner. Mr. Tyner was a World War II veteran of the US Navy and
the US Army. He was a retired engineer from the US Civil Service and a
member of Socastee Baptist Church.

Surviving are his wife of 55 years, Madge Mills Tyner; sons, James M. Tyner,
Jr. and wife, Jane, of Charleston and Gary Timothy Tyner and wife, Cynthia,
of Surfside Beach; daughters, Evan Ann Tyner of Socastee, Nan T. Hill and
husband, Gerald, of Orange City, Fla., Terry Watts and husband, Michael, of
Socastee and Tabitha Brown and husband, Mark, of Murrells Inlet; eleven
grandchildren; six great grandchildren and sisters, Alice Bennett of
Socastee and Dorothy Hodge Parker of Lumberton, N.C.
